Harmonicity of a function via harmonicity of its spherical means
Abstract
It is proved that harmonic functions are characterized by harmonicity of their spherical means, for which purpose the iterated spherical means are used. The similar characterization of solutions to the modified Helmholtz equation (panharmonic functions) is given. Another description of harmonic functions is the pointwise equality of a function and its iterated mean over an admissible pair of spheres.
